Click Programs and Features to continue. You will see the Uninstall or change a program interface where you can find the software you have installed on your computer. Then, you can right-click on the NVIDIA driver you want to uninstall and then select Uninstall from the pop-up menu to uninstall the NVIDIA driver. For Windows 8, Windows and Windows 10, there is a program called AMD Software. And In Windows 7, there will be the AMD Catalyst Install Manager. You should uninstall the AMD Software or the AMD Catalyst Install Manager. And then a prompt will remind you whether to uninstall the AMD Driver or not, click Yes.
